High-Yield Explanation
Dietary fibre contains remnants of plant cells resistant to hydrolysis by the enzymes of alimentary canal. Fibre is basically composed of 2 categories : 1. Water insoluble components. 2 . Warer soluble components. 1. Water insoluble : Cellulose, Hemicellulose, Lignin 2. Water soluble : Pectins, Mucilagesn, Gums.
